Welcome to the British Student Taekwondo Federation, a registered charity promoting the martial art and sport of Taekwondo throughout UK universities. Governed by an elected board of trustees, we deliver training camps, courses and tournaments in all disciplines of Taekwondo and provide representation and support services available to all university Taekwondo clubs.

Financial history
Financial period end date
Income / Expenditure | 30/06/2020 | 30/06/2021 | 30/06/2022 | 30/06/2023 | 30/06/2024 |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
|
Total gross income | £74.31k | £37.38k | £86.84k | £45.98k | £119.19k | |
|
Total expenditure | £72.54k | £27.33k | £77.90k | £43.20k | £123.49k | |
|
Income from government contracts | N/A | N/A | N/A | N/A | N/A | |
|
Income from government grants | N/A | N/A | N/A | N/A | N/A |

Charitable objects
THE ADVANCEMENT F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T OF PHYSICAL EDUCATION AMONG STUDENTS IN UNIVERSITIES AND COLLEGES BY THE PROVISION OF SERVICES AND PROMOTION THE MARTIAL ART AND AMATEUR SPORT OF TAEKWONDO.
